The original castle consisted of the keep, seen here against the sunset, which provided a series of gun platforms to protect Falmouth harbour and lodging for the governor. Pendennis Castle was begun in 1540 as part of Henry VIII's defence of the south coast. A large enclosing fortress was added in Elizabeth I's reign.
